I like the OMC stuff as well. Previously I’d only used the cheap really sticky stuff that sticks to everything in your rod bag or rig board, but the OMC stuff is nice and malleable, stays put on your rig and hardens off in the water and becomes non sticky on the outside. Seems a lot heavier than the cheap stuff too, meaning you need less to balance pop ups etc.

I’ve been using the same pot of Kryston Heavy Metal putty for years as I’m very particular about reusing whatever I can from old rigs etc. However, my once mighty blob, is mighty no more and I need to restock. It’s tricky to apply but once worked a bit is good and very weighty. Does anyone have any other suggestions before I buy another pot? I’m sure things have moved on since I bought the last lot. It does seem to be a fair bit more expensive than other brands but seeing how long the last lot lasted that’s not too much of a concern. Just wondered if I’m missing out.
